Maintaining a healthy balance of bacteria in your mouth is crucial for overall oral health. The mouth is home to millions of bacteria, and while some of these are beneficial, others can lead to problems if they become predominant. An imbalance can result in various oral health issues, such as gum disease, tooth decay, and even bad breath. Recognizing the signs that your mouth bacteria may be out of balance can help you take the necessary steps to restore that balance.
One of the most common signs of an imbalance in oral bacteria is persistent bad breath, also known as halitosis. While occasional bad breath is common after meals, chronic bad breath may indicate an underlying issue. The bacteria in the mouth break down food particles and produce byproducts that contribute to foul odors. If brushing, flossing, or mouthwash does not remedy the situation, it may be time to assess your oral hygiene routine and consider factors that could be exacerbating the problem.
Another indicator of bacterial imbalance is swollen or bleeding gums. Healthy gums are firm and do not bleed when you brush or floss. When harmful bacteria outnumber the beneficial ones, they can cause inflammation in the gums, leading to gingivitis or even more severe periodontal disease. If you notice these symptoms, it’s essential to examine your dental hygiene practices and possibly consult a dental professional.
Dry mouth, or xerostomia, is another sign that your mouth bacteria could be out of balance. Saliva plays a crucial role in maintaining oral health by helping wash away food particles and balance the bacteria. A reduction in saliva production can lead to an environment where harmful bacteria can thrive, leading to an increased risk of cavities and infections. If you frequently experience dry mouth, it’s essential to investigate the cause, whether it’s medication side effects, dehydration, or some other health issue.
Changes in taste sensation can also indicate an imbalance in oral bacteria. A metal or unusual taste in your mouth might suggest that certain bacteria are overgrowing. This can be distressing, as it may alter your perception of food, which can lead to changes in diet and overall health. Consult your healthcare provider if you experience unexplained changes in taste.
